Was Vehicle Towed: - | Description of the Complaints: I was driving on hwy 60, towards lexington va. this is a narrow four lane, divided by a grassy median, there are very few places to pull over. as i was driving uphill, at about 55 mph, my hood flew up and smashed against the windshield, and wrapped around the roof of the car. i was passing a log truck when this happened, and there wasn't anywhere to pull over, so i drove looking through the curve under the hood, and used all of my mirrors until i could get to a safe place to pull over. my 13 yr. old son was in the passenger side, and we were both completely in shock. the damage to my car, approximately $4000.00. the other complaint i have is i had to wait 8 weeks for hyundai to get a hood for my cars, make, model and year. they said, the hoods were on back order and they didn't know when thy would be able to get my hood. i had to pay for the damage with my insurance, i think hyundai should pay for all of the expenses, that everyone incurred from this defect. not just the rise in insurance premiums, but also, the rental cars. *jb |
